Лабораторные работы по программированию на языке высокого уровня. Работа с функциями языка Си

Этот материал можно скачать бесплатно

Состав работы

material.view.file_icon
material.view.file_icon
material.view.file_icon 1.C
material.view.file_icon 1.EXE
material.view.file_icon Лабораторная работа №3.doc
material.view.file_icon
material.view.file_icon 1.C
material.view.file_icon 1.EXE
material.view.file_icon Лабораторная работа №4.doc
material.view.file_icon
material.view.file_icon 1.C
material.view.file_icon 1.EXE
material.view.file_icon VUZ.DAT
material.view.file_icon Лабораторная работа №5.doc
Работа представляет собой rar архив с файлами (распаковать онлайн), которые открываются в программах:
  • Microsoft Word

Описание

Лабораторная работа №3
Работа с функциями языка Си
Лабораторная работа №4
Работа с массивом структур
Лабораторная работа №5
Работа с файлами языка Си
3. Используя функцию, написать программу по своему варианту.
Написать функцию вычисления произведения прямоугольной матрицы A размера k x m на прямоугольную матрицу B размера m x n. В главной программе обратиться к этой функции.

4.Создать массив структур и выполнить задание согласно своему варианту.
Дана информация о пяти школах. Структура имеет вид: номер школы, год, количество выпускников, число поступивших в ВУЗы. Вывести данные об общем количестве выпускников и доле поступивших в ВУЗ.

5.Используя функции и режим меню, создать файл из 10 структур, просмотреть файл, добавить в файл новую информацию и, применяя режим прямого доступа, выполнить задание по своему варианту.
Структура имеет вид: название вуза, число студентов, количество факультетов. Добавить в конец файла информацию
Работа с функциями языка Си
Лабораторная работа № 3 По дисциплине: Программирование на языке высокого уровня (2 часть) Тема: Работа с функциями языка Си Задание 1 : Используя функцию, написать программу по своему варианту. Варианты задания Написать функцию, которая вычисляет для заданной квадратной матрицы A её симметричную часть S(ij)=(A(ij)+A(ji))/2 и кососимметричную часть K(ij)=(A(ij)-A(ji))/2.
User maxgalll : 10 июня 2010
40 руб.
Лабораторная работа №1. Программирование на языках высокого уровня (Си)
Задание №1: Составьте и выполните программу линейной структуры x=4y2/(4z–2t3) при t = 1; z = 3; y = sin(t). Задание №2: Составьте программы разветвляющейся структуры (используя IF). Даны четыре числа. Вычислить сумму положительных среди них чисел. Задание №3: Составьте программы разветвляющейся структуры (используя SWITCH). Вводится число программ N<=20. Напечатать фразу «Я разработал N программ», согласовав слово «программа» с числом N.
User Discursus : 15 июня 2017
120 руб.
Лабораторная работа №1. Программирование на языках высокого уровня (Си)
Лабораторная работа №2. Программирование на языках высокого уровня (Си)
Задание №1: Составьте 3 варианта программ циклической структуры типа for, while, do…while и сравните полученные результаты. Задание №2: Даны вещественные числа a=-2; b=5; Значения функции f(x)=x2/(10+x3) записать в массив. Вычислить значение интеграла, используя: 1) Формулу трапеций I1=h*[f(a)/2+f(a+h)+f(a+2h)+…+f(a+(n-1)h)+f(b)/2] 2) Формулу Симпсона I2=h/3*(f(a)+f(b)+4*(f(a+h)+f(a+3h)+…+f(a+(n-1)h))+2*(f(a+2h)+f(a+4h)+…+f(a+(n-2)h))) h=(b-a)/n, n=100
User Discursus : 15 июня 2017
120 руб.
Лабораторная работа №2. Программирование на языках высокого уровня (Си)
Лабораторная работа №4. Программирование на языках высокого уровня (Си)
Задание №1: Создать массив структур. Дана информация о 10 студентах. Структура имеет вид: фамилия, год рождения, факультет. Вывести данные о студентах по заданному факультету.
User Discursus : 15 июня 2017
143 руб.
Лабораторная работа №4. Программирование на языках высокого уровня (Си)
Лабораторная работа №3. Программирование на языках высокого уровня (Си)
Задание №1: Написать функцию, сортирующую в порядке возрастания элементы одномерного массива. В главной программе вызвать функцию для двух разных массивов.
User Discursus : 15 июня 2017
120 руб.
Лабораторная работа №3. Программирование на языках высокого уровня (Си)
Лабораторная работа №5. Программирование на языках высокого уровня (Си)
Задание №1: Используя функции и режим меню, создать файл из 10 структур, просмотреть файл, вывести данные о самом высоком спортсмене (структура имеет вид: фамилия, пол, год рождения и рост), добавить в файл новую информацию применяя режим прямого доступа.
User Discursus : 15 июня 2017
151 руб.
Лабораторная работа №5. Программирование на языках высокого уровня (Си)
Лабораторная работа №3. Программирование на языке высокого уровня (pascal)
Задание: Задана последовательность значений элементов некоторого массива до и после преобразования по некоторому правилу. Определите алгоритм преобразования и напишите программу, которая: 1) формирует массив из заданного количества случайных целых чисел в заданном диапазоне и выводит элементы массива на экран; 2) по определенному вами алгоритму преобразовывает этот массив и выводит на экран элементы преобразованного массива. 3) производит заданные вычисления и выводит результат на экран. • М
User Discursus : 20 января 2017
100 руб.
Лабораторная работа №3. Программирование на языке высокого уровня (pascal)
Лабораторная работа №1. Программирование на языке высокого уровня (pascal)
Разработать программу для вычисления: 1) значения арифметического выражения; 2) значения функции; и вывода на экран полученных результатов.
User Discursus : 20 января 2017
100 руб.
Лабораторная работа №1. Программирование на языке высокого уровня (pascal)
Расчет активного полосового фильтра
РАСЧЕТ АКТИВНОГО ПОЛОСОВОГО ФИЛЬТРА по дисциплине «Моделирование систем» в архиве схемы microcap, чертежи в формате pdf, cdr работа с титульным листом и ПЗ Тема: Расчет активного полосового фильтра Исходные данные к работе: 1. Разработать активный полосовой фильтр с параметрами: коэффициент усиления напряжения К = 40 дБ; средняя частота полосы пропускания: FСР = 1 кГц; полоса пропускания: dF = 150 Гц; сопротивление нагрузки R = 2 кОм; амплитуда входного сигнала UВХ = 10 мВ; внут
User stserg31 : 6 апреля 2015
2000 руб.
Расчет активного полосового фильтра
Резьбовые соединения деталей. НГТУ. Вариант 1. Автокад
Упражнения для защиты задания «Резьбовые соединения деталей» На предложенном изображении заменить вид спереди на половину вида совмещенную с половиной фронтального разреза. Сделано в форматах А4 и А3 Сделано в автокаде. + пдф. Если нужен нанокад, то нанокад открывает чертежи автокада
User Laguz : 5 февраля 2025
100 руб.
Резьбовые соединения деталей. НГТУ. Вариант 1. Автокад
Контрольная работа по дисциплине: Операционные системы реального времени. Вариант №9, 29
Контрольная работа Вариант №9 по материалу второй главы курса "Взаимодействие с помощью сообщений" В данной работе предлагается разработать модель электростанции. На электростанции имеется пункт заготовления топлива, транспортное средство и четыре энергоблока (котла). Пункт заготовления делает топливо из сырого материала. Объём изготовленной порции всякий раз разный, т.к. зависит от количества и качества сырья (моделируется случайным числом). Когда порция топлива готова, транспортное средство
User IT-STUDHELP : 27 декабря 2022
280 руб.
promo
Структуры и алгоритмы обработки данных (2-я часть). Лабораторные работы №1-5. Решены все варианты
1. Тема: Построение двоичного дерева. Вычисление характеристик дерева. Цель работы: Освоить понятие двоичного дерева. 2. Тема: Построение случайного дерева поиска и идеально сбалансированного дерева поиска Цель работы: Освоить методы построения случайного дерева поиска и идеально сбалансированного дерева поиска. 3. Тема: Построение АВЛ-дерева. Цель работы: Освоить построение АВЛ-дерева. 4. Тема: Построение двоичного Б-дерева. Цель работы: Освоить построение двоичного Б-дерева. 5. Тема: Постр
User tpogih : 11 января 2015
70 руб.
promo
up Наверх